In this Blog Post You will learn about how you can submit html form data directly to your google sheets.
Get StartedIntroduction:
In today's digital age, capturing user data is essential for businesses and organizations. One effective way to collect and manage data is by utilizing HTML forms. In this article, we will explore a step-by-step guide on how to submit HTML form data directly to Google Sheets, thanks to a tutorial by Code with Sundeep. By following this method, you can seamlessly gather and store user information for further analysis and processing. Let's dive in!
Step 1: Create a Google Sheet
The first step is to set up a Google Sheet to store the form data. Open Google Sheets and create a new spreadsheet. Rename the sheet as per your preference.
Step 2: Enable Google Sheets API and Generate Credentials
To access and manipulate the Google Sheets data, you need to enable the Google Sheets API. Follow the instructions provided in the tutorial by Code with Sundeep, specifically the section on enabling the Google Sheets API and generating the required credentials.
Step 3: Design your HTML Form
Now it's time to design your HTML form. You can use any text editor or integrated development environment (IDE) to create an HTML file. Follow the HTML form structure as demonstrated in the tutorial. Make sure to add appropriate input fields for the data you want to collect, such as name, email, phone number, etc.
Step 4: Link the HTML Form to Google Sheets
To link your HTML form to Google Sheets, you need to modify the JavaScript code provided in the tutorial. In the code, locate the scriptURL variable and replace it with the URL of your Google Sheets API endpoint. This endpoint can be obtained by following the tutorial's instructions on how to generate the URL.
Step 5: Connect the HTML Form with JavaScript
Next, you need to establish a connection between the HTML form and JavaScript. Locate the <script> tag in your HTML file and copy the JavaScript code provided in the tutorial. Insert the code within the <script> tag. This code allows the form data to be collected and submitted to Google Sheets.
Step 6: Test and Deploy your HTML Form
To ensure everything is working correctly, test your HTML form by filling in the fields and submitting the data. Open the HTML file in your web browser, enter some sample data, and submit the form. If the form submission is successful, you should see the data reflected in your Google Sheets spreadsheet.
Step 7: Customize and Expand
Once you have successfully linked your HTML form to Google Sheets, you can further customize and expand its functionality. For instance, you can add form validation to ensure data integrity, incorporate additional fields, or implement success and error messages. The tutorial provided by Code with Sundeep can serve as a starting point for these enhancements.
Conclusion:
Submitting HTML form data to Google Sheets provides a convenient way to collect and manage user information. By following the step-by-step guide provided by Code with Sundeep, you can easily integrate your HTML forms with Google Sheets, eliminating the need for manual data entry. This automation streamlines data collection and enhances the efficiency of your workflows. So go ahead and implement this solution, and unlock the power of Google Sheets for managing your form data with ease.